    Redskins hope season opener isn't a foreshadow of fall

    WASHINGTON (AP) -- The Washington Redskins are on pace to set another scoring record in exhibition games -- this time for fewest points.

    Dropped passes, no rushing game, four turnovers, 113 yards of penalties and an overall lack of disciplined play gave coach Steve Spurrier his first shutout loss in 16 years.

    ``They can't accuse us of trying to win in the preseason, now can they, with the way we looked,'' Spurrier said after the Redskins dropped their exhibition opener 20-0 to Carolina on Saturday night.
